`vecp, vecq, vec` be vectors such that `vecq.vecr=0` and `vecp.vecq!=0`. Let `alpha` is real constant such that `vecx.vecp=alpha, vecx xx vecq=vecr`, then `vecx-lamda_(1)vecq=lamda_(2)(vecp xx vecr)` where

A

`lamda_(1)=(alpha)/(vecp.vecq)`

B

`lamda_(2)=1/(vecp.vecq)`

C

`lamda_(2)=1/(vecr.vecq)`

D

`lamda_(1)=(alpha)/(vecr.vecq)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A, B

`vecpxx(vecx xx vecq)=(vecp.vecq)-(vecp.vecx)vecq=vecpxxvecr`
`vecx=((vecp.vecx)vecq)/(vecp.vecq)+((vecpxxvecr))/(vecp.vecq)=(alpha)/(vecp.vecq) vecq+((vecp+vecr))/(vecp.vecq)`
